The Bread/Flour/Grain Trading Game: Bidding in and Designing Auction Events

Strategic sourcing and more specifically, e-procurement have become part of standard industry practice in recent years with the use of forward and reverse auction events. Training materials and games to teach participants to bid in and design such events, however, has been limited. In this paper we describe a Bread/Flour/Grain trading game we developed for instructors to use with student groups. We also provide accompanying materials and suggestions for running and debriefing of the game. The game imparts design and bidding experience, which students can then apply to real world auction events. It is appropriate for group sizes ranging from six to sixty.
